Key Cloudflare Firewall Rules for WP Protection
Protecting your WordPress website from malicious traffic requires more than just extensions; a robust CF WAF setup is absolutely important. Establishing several fundamental WAF configurations in CF can significantly minimize the risk of breaches. For case, block frequent virus URLs, restrict access based on geographical region, and employ rate limiting to prevent brute-force attempts. Furthermore, consider creating settings to challenge automated scripts and reject traffic from known bad IP addresses. Regularly checking and modifying these settings is equally vital to maintain a robust security defense.
